About
Supervise radiography faculty and staff; establish department goals and determine teaching assignments. Maintain all ARRT records, prepare annual reports, and lead the self-study process for JRCERT accreditation. Monitor the department budget and expenditures to maintain an effective and resourceful program. Develop and maintain a functional curriculum; evaluate course content, review new texts, and collaborate with administration on program implementation. Student Success & Mentorship
Maintain an 80% student success rate; review performance data and implement intervention plans to reduce student withdrawals. Secure new clinical sites, manage agreements, and conduct site visits to evaluate student progress and ensure effective clinical education. Perform functions of a Radiography instructor, preparing didactic instruction, course objectives, and student performance evaluations. Maintain student grades per established policies and prepare final grades for transcripts at the end of each semester. Professional Development & Community Engagement
Coordinate and arrange educational workshops and in-services for didactic and clinical faculty. Serve as the primary link between the campus, the San Antonio clinical community, and the Program Advisory Board. Minimum Requirements:
Master's degree from a USDE or CHEA-recognized accredited institution. Graduate of an accredited Radiologic Technology program. Minimum 2 years of documented instructional experience in a JRCERT-accredited Radiography program. Minimum 3 years of full-time clinical experience in medical imaging. Current ARRT registration in Radiologic Sciences or unrestricted Texas state license, plus all credentials required by law.
